Balsamic Chicken Breast with Spinach and Tomatoes

Description

Juicy chicken breasts are seared to perfection and simmered in a sweet-tangy balsamic glaze with fresh spinach and cherry tomatoes. This one-pan meal is quick, healthy, and bursting with flavor.


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 3 cups fresh spinach
  • 1/3 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h basil for garnish (optional)


Instructions

  1. Season chicken breasts with salt and pepper on both sides.
  2.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add chicken and cook for 5-6 minutes per side until golden and cooked through. Remove chicken from skillet and set aside.
  3. In the same skillet, reduce heat to medium.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ant. Add cherry tomatoes and cook for 2-3 minutes until they start to soften.
  4. Stir in balsamic vinegar, honey, and oregano. Bring to a simmer and let cook for 2 minutes until slightly thickened.
  5. Return chicken to the skillet. Add spinach and toss gently, letting the spinach wilt for 1-2 minutes.
  6. Serve chicken topped with the spinach-tomato mixture and drizzle with additional glaze. Garnish with fresh basil if desired.

Notes

You can customize the seasonings to taste. For a thicker glaze, let the sauce simmer longer. Substitute chicken thighs if preferred.
